How to Be a Good Poker Player

Poker is a card game that requires skill and strategy to win. Players bet on their hands and raise or fold until someone has all of the chips. There are many different variations of the game, but most are played with a small group of players around a table. A dealer is responsible for dealing the cards. The players then place their bets in the pot according to their strategy.

To be a good poker player, you need to know how to read your opponents. This includes looking for physical tells and analyzing their betting patterns. You should also learn how to use bluffing to your advantage. However, this is an advanced technique that should be used infrequently.

It is important to manage your bankroll. You should never play more than you can afford to lose. This will prevent you from getting discouraged when you are losing. It is also important to stay focused and patient. By following these tips, you can improve your game and increase your chances of winning.

A good poker player will know how to make the most of a bad hand. This is similar to life in that there are times when you will need to take a risk in order to get ahead. However, you should always weigh the risks and rewards of each decision before making it. You will often find that a moderate amount of risk can yield a large reward.
